2001 Supreme(Ker) 90

N.KRISHNAN NAIR
Anand Mohan – Appellant
Versus
Additional Sub Inspector of Police – Respondent


Judgment :-

N. Krishnan Nair, J.

This is a petition filed under S.482 of the Code of Criminal Procedure to quash Annexures 1 and 2 and all further proceedings pursuant to the same in C.P. No. 130/2000 on the file of the Judicial First Class Magistrate, Thiruvalla. The petitioner is accused in C.P. No. 130/2000 on the file of the Judicial First Class Magistrate, Thiruvalla. The petitioner is alleged to have committed the offence punishable under S.55(a), (i) and (h) of the Abkari Act. The allegation is that on 23.12.1998 the police seized 30 litres of spirit from the house of the petitioner.

2. The Circle Inspector of Police, Thiruvalla, conducted the investigation in the case. Subsequently the Additional Sub Inspector of Police, Thiruvalla, submitted a charge sheet before the Court. Since the charge sheet was not accompanied by the chemical examination report the learned Magistrate returned the charge sheet. The Additional Sub Inspector resubmitted the charge sheet.
